令牌环的标准 令牌环

令牌环是一种用于控制分布式系统中资源访问的机制。它通过在系统中传递一个令牌,来限制对资源的访问。在这篇文章中,我们将介绍令牌环的标准,以及如何使用令牌环来管理分布式系统中的资源。

令牌环的基本原理

令牌环的基本原理是,系统中的每个节点都有一个令牌,这个令牌会按照一定的顺序在节点之间传递。当一个节点需要访问资源时,它必须等待令牌到达自己的位置,然后才能进行访问。当节点完成了对资源的访问后,它会将令牌传递给下一个节点。

令牌环的优点

令牌环的主要优点是,它可以有效地控制系统中的资源访问。由于令牌只能在一个节点上存在,因此只有持有令牌的节点才能访问资源。这样可以避免多个节点同时访问同一个资源,从而提高系统的性能和可靠性。

另外,令牌环还可以实现负载均衡。当系统中的节点数量增加时,令牌环可以自动调整令牌的传递顺序,从而保证每个节点都能够平均地访问资源。

令牌环的应用场景

令牌环通常用于分布式系统中的资源管理。例如,在一个分布式数据库系统中,令牌环可以用来控制对数据库的访问。只有持有令牌的节点才能够执行数据库操作,从而避免多个节点同时访问数据库,导致数据不一致的问题。

另外,令牌环还可以用于分布式计算系统中的任务调度。当一个节点完成了一个任务后,它会将令牌传递给下一个节点,从而触发下一个任务的执行。这样可以实现任务的自动调度和负载均衡。

令牌环是一种非常有效的分布式系统资源管理机制。它可以通过限制资源访问来提高系统的性能和可靠性,同时还可以实现负载均衡和任务调度等功能。在设计分布式系统时,我们可以考虑使用令牌环来管理系统中的资源。